Index-push after fixes (write channel, gated): once crawl/indexing fixes ship, python3 "${CLAUDE_PLUGIN_ROOT}/scripts/connectors/indexpush.py" indexnow <fixed-urls…> --key $INDEXNOW_KEY notifies Bing, DuckDuckGo, Yandex, Seznam, and Naver within minutes, and indexpush.py baidu … --site <site> --token $BAIDU_PUSH_TOKEN does the same for Baidu. Mutation-class helper: dry-run by default, --live to submit; ownership is inherent (hosted key file / site-bound token). Google exposes no equivalent open endpoint — its Indexing API is restricted to job-posting/broadcast pages, so Google discovery still goes through sitemaps + the GSC URL Inspection read.

When a user requests a technical SEO audit, use the compact step templates in references/technical-audit-templates.md. Every step should capture evidence, checks, issues, fixes, and a score.
- Audit Crawlability — review robots.txt, sitemap discovery, crawl waste, redirect chains, and orphan patterns.
- Audit Indexability — verify coverage, blockers (
noindex, X-Robots, robots.txt, canonicals), duplicate signals, and 4xx/5xx failures. - Audit Site Speed & Core Web Vitals — evaluate LCP/INP/CLS plus supporting metrics, resource weight, and highest-impact fixes.
- Audit Mobile-Friendliness — check viewport setup, layout fit, tap targets, and mobile-first parity.
- Audit Security & HTTPS — confirm SSL health, HTTPS enforcement, mixed content, HSTS, and security headers.
- Audit URL Structure — inspect URL patterns, parameters, case consistency, and redirect hygiene.
- Audit Structured Data — validate schema, map missing opportunities, and note CORE-EEAT
O05implications. ⚠ Raw fetches miss client-side-injected JSON-LD (Yoast/RankMath/AIOSEO render via JS); verify with the rendered DOM (document.querySelectorAll('script[type="application/ld+json"]')) or Rich Results Test before reporting "no schema". - Audit International SEO (if applicable) — verify hreflang, return tags, locale targeting, and
x-default. - Generate Technical Audit Summary — roll findings into a scorecard, priority queue, quick wins, roadmap, and monitoring plan.
Audit Notes
- Rendering (step 1 & 7) — AI crawlers don't execute JS; critical content and JSON-LD must be in the initial HTML. SSR/SSG ships it server-side; pure CSR hides it until hydration, so client-injected content and schema can go unseen. Compare raw fetch vs rendered DOM.
- Core Web Vitals thresholds (step 3) — pass: LCP <2.5s, INP <200ms, CLS <0.1.
- Crawl-budget checklist (step 1) — flag faceted-nav explosion (filter/sort combinations), parameterized URLs (tracking/session params creating duplicates), and session-ID URLs. Each multiplies crawlable URLs and wastes budget on near-duplicates.
